    All nutrients comparison - raw data values

    Nutrient Beverages, carbonated, orange Coca-Cola DV% diff.
    Caffeine 8mg 2%
    Copper 0.015mg 0.001mg 2%
    Iron 0.06mg 0.11mg 1%
    Phosphorus 1mg 10mg 1%
    Zinc 0.1mg 0.02mg 1%
    Calories 48kcal 37kcal 1%
    Carbs 12.3g 9.56g 1%
    Protein 0g 0.07g 0%
    Fats 0g 0.02g 0%
    Net carbs 12.3g 9.56g N/A
    Magnesium 1mg 0mg 0%
    Calcium 5mg 2mg 0%
    Potassium 2mg 2mg 0%
    Sugar 8.97g N/A
    Sodium 12mg 4mg 0%
    Manganese 0.013mg 0.002mg 0%
    Selenium 0µg 0.1µg 0%
    Choline 0.6mg 0.3mg 0%
